Application Analyst III - Epic
GoHealth Urgent Care is a healthcare organization seeking an Application Analyst III for Epic applications. This role involves leading the design, implementation, and optimization of Epic applications, providing strategic guidance, mentoring junior staff, and ensuring alignment with organizational goals.

Responsibilities
Lead in the design and build of Epic applications, including integrated areas
Independently research and configure systems to improve processes, add efficiencies, and promote patient safety
Collaborate with operations and application team members to optimize workflows and application capabilities
Ability to identify change impact of owned (application responsible for) and non-owned Epic applications and integrated areas related to technology, patient safety, data integrity/compliance, and finance
Utilize external resources and best practices to inform Epic applications build decisions
Build data fields, screens, templates, and customer-defined functionality in Epic applications as required
Conduct thorough reviews of Foundation Build and operational content for Epic applications
Participate in unit, application, and integrated testing for implementations, upgrades, and enhancements for Epic applications
Review proposed training curriculum for Epic applications in collaboration with the application team
Follow Epic applications build standards and maintain synchronization between environments in coordination with the environment team
Provide go-live and post-go-live support for new Epic applications and functionality
Participate in on-call rotation to support Epic applications users
Represent Epic applications in Integrated Area Workgroups
Support continuous documentation of system modifications and updates for Epic applications
Demonstrate general knowledge of the systems development life cycle and apply appropriate methods to support ongoing maintenance for Epic applications
Maintain detailed and ongoing communication with customers (end users or operational owners) through ticketing systems
Ensure all assigned Epic incident, catalog, and enhancement tickets include clear resolution details
Contact customers (end users or operational owners) directly regarding ticket resolution or if requests cannot be fulfilled
Log decisions, issues, and risks in trackers (e.g., Orion, Nova) during Epic applications build and upgrade cycles
